[使用间接免疫荧光法对全自动抗核抗体检测分析仪的评估]

[Evaluation of a Fully Automated Analyzer for Antinuclear Antibody Test Using Indirect Immunofluorescence Assay].

作者信息

Uto Kenichi, Hayashi Nobuhide, Oyabu Chinami, Sato Itsuko, Saegusa Jun

出版信息

Rinsho Byori. 2017 Feb;65(2):131-137.

PMID:30762978
Abstract

The fully automated HELIOS® system for antinuclear antibody (ANA) test is capable of automatically per- forming all IFA procedures. We evaluated the analytical performance, characteristics and utility of HELIOS system as ANA screening test. We compared HELIOS system and the conventional methods in sera from 161 connective tissue disease (CTD) patients and 250 healthy individuals. The presence and titer of ANA were automatically determined by performing HELIOS system at 1:80 dilution and the ANA titers were com- pensated by several dilution and visual determination in sera with a high ANA titer and ANA-positive sera combined with anti-cytoplasmic antibody. The ANA staining patterns were assessed by visual determination of the digital image on HELIOS system. The total concordance rate between the conventional method and HELIOS system was 94.4%. The concordance of ANA titer (within ± 1 tube difference) between the con- ventional method and automated or compensated evaluation of HELIOS system was 85.7% or 98.8%, respec- tively. The concordance rate of six nuclear staining patterns was from 81.4% to 100% and the discrepancies of granular staining pattern might be caused by the fixation of HEp-2 cells. The positive rates of ANA in CTD patients and healthy individuals were comparable with the conventional methods. Taken together, HELIOS system can appropriately perform the automated determination of ANA except in some cases and is useful as ANA screening test. Furthermore, this system can contribute not only an efficient IFA procedure but also the ANA standardization by IFA. [Original].

摘要

用于抗核抗体(ANA)检测的全自动HELIOS®系统能够自动执行所有间接免疫荧光法(IFA)程序。我们评估了HELIOS系统作为ANA筛查试验的分析性能、特点和实用性。我们比较了HELIOS系统与传统方法在161例结缔组织病(CTD)患者和250名健康个体血清中的检测结果。通过在1:80稀释度下运行HELIOS系统自动确定ANA的存在和滴度,对于高ANA滴度血清以及ANA阳性血清与抗细胞质抗体组合的情况,通过多次稀释和目视判定来补偿ANA滴度。通过目视判定HELIOS系统上的数字图像来评估ANA染色模式。传统方法与HELIOS系统之间的总符合率为94.4%。传统方法与HELIOS系统的自动或补偿评估之间ANA滴度(相差±1管以内)的符合率分别为85.7%或98.8%。六种核染色模式的符合率为81.4%至100%,颗粒状染色模式的差异可能是由HEp-2细胞的固定所致。CTD患者和健康个体中ANA的阳性率与传统方法相当。综上所述,HELIOS系统除在某些情况下外能够适当地进行ANA的自动检测,可作为ANA筛查试验。此外,该系统不仅有助于高效的IFA程序,还能通过IFA实现ANA标准化。[原文]
